Output 35b9c86cb646a9cfe53662e1818af5d53a4056fb74ec1e2520c2caaf59c18a76:2

value
68200435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ebf3ba443b03899cf905f37816e9babaafb77c71 OP_EQUAL
address
3PCch7c3ijh5PbTaStkXVQSJBoM8MKNk6T
transaction
35b9c86cb646a9cfe53662e1818af5d53a4056fb74ec1e2520c2caaf59c18a76
confirmations
376282
spent
true